Lime & Lemon Indian Grill & Bar


Modern Indian
This modern Indian eatery will transport your taste buds through India’s many regions with aromatic curries, sizzling tandoori dishes, and handcrafted cocktails. Perfect for sharing! We think it’s some of the best Indian food in the Triangle. The menu choices are huge with a large selection of vegan and vegetarian options to suit all preferences. Consider ordering the lamb rogan josh or a Goat Chettinad, followed up with a creamy pistachio kulfi for dessert! It’s a must to try one of their colorful and creative Indian style cocktails.

Lobera Tacos & Tequila


Authentic Mexican flavors
Because nothing says “I love you” like tacos and margaritas! This spot brings authentic Mexican flavors with fresh ingredients and craft tequila cocktails. A great date meal will start with a fresh serving of guacamole, followed by yummy Birriamania tacos, Big Bad Wolf Burrito topped with mole sauce, and paired with a spicy blood orange margarita. Now, do you choose creme caramel, tres leches, or a flan for dessert? You’re on a date… share both.
Lobera also has some great $10 lunch deals, so why not make it a daytime date. Or consider a weekend brunch with a serving of Tres Leches French Toast or huevos con Chorizo (also great prices)! We had a lovely dinner date here before attending a ComedyWorx show just down the road.

Gussie’s


Cozy neighborhood bar
Gussie’s is a cozy neighborhood bar, bottle shop, and kitchen on West Morgan Street serving creative craft cocktails and delicious meals. Start with drunken mussels or fried pickle chips, followed by lentil Bolognese, or chili cheese smash burger, and finish with a key lime pie or apple caramel bread pudding.
Take a Valentine’s spin on their old friends | new friends cocktail menu. New lovers might enjoy a Sea Legs old-fashioned, and longtime lovers, the American Trilogy. A Valentine’s Day date experience at Gussies is for those couples who love a casual, yet intimate atmosphere.

Wake N Bakery

Talk about low-key. Wake N Bake coffee shop and bakery may be a fun adventure date for long-term couples, or those testing the connection. This Raleigh bakery with a difference specializes in hemp-infused products, including naturally derived Delta-9 THC (all in compliance with the 2018 Farm Bill’s federal legal limit of 0.3%.) Its mission is to be an all-inclusive joint that fosters calm, enhances well-being, and spreads love and good vibes.


Hemp-infused products
You can choose from drinks & freshly baked goodies, all clearly labeled with THC and CBD levels. Be sure to know your limits – and if not, ask, the staff will help you take it easy – then relax into a comfy chair and enjoy those deep conversations and possible giggles.

Gregg Museum + Coffee | Lunch Date

For a simple and meaningful way to connect, stroll through inspiring exhibits and then chat over coffee at a nearby café (or lunch or afternoon drink). The Gregg Museum of Art & Design is a bit of a hidden gem on the NC State campus. Opened in 2017, the Gregg is a free collecting and exhibiting museum with more than 54,000 objects in its collection and is one of the top museums in Raleigh.

From 19th century Japanese color woodblock prints to antique North Carolina quilts, their objects span cultures, disciplines, and designs. They also have the most gorgeous magnolia tree in the front garden – snap a romantic selfie and pretend that stunning canopy is a mistletoe!

Movie Marathon and Cocktails

We mentioned heading down to the cellar of Wolfe & Porter above for a sophisticated end to the evening. You can do that or enjoy their special Valentines’ Day Event which I believe is in their upstairs space. Valentine’s Day at Raleigh’s Wolfe & Porter will include flash tattoos, Valentine-themed cocktails, rom-com movie marathon and a DIY photo booth. One cocktail special is Love Potion #69 Slushie with dragonfruit, lime, tequila and orange blossom topped with a cherry; $10 (photos available). The bar will be open 2 p.m.-midnight Feb. 14; the flash tattoos by Gabi of Tattoo Honey will be from 3-7 p.m.
